Take a look! A section of a seldom-used dock along the waterfront in Charleston, South Carolina, is now a nesting ground for least terns threatened in the state.
Volunteers from NOAA, the South Carolina Department of Natural Resources, South Carolina Audubon, and others transformed part of an old Navy dock into an unlikely nesting hotspot for the least tern. As of August 7, 2016, least terns have created seven nests (and hatched eleven chicks!) on the pier behind NOAA's Office for Coastal Management.
